Evolution of Electabuzz
To evolve Electabuzz into Electivire, you need to follow these steps:
- Have Electabuzz hold an Electirizer: An Electirizer is a unique evolution item that can be used to evolve Electabuzz into Electivire.
- Trade Electabuzz: Trading is the only way to evolve Electabuzz into Electivire. You need to trade Electabuzz with another player while it is holding the Electirizer.

Evolution of Magmar
To evolve Magmar into Magmortar, you need to follow these steps:
- Have Magmar hold a Magmarizer: A Magmarizer is a unique evolution item that can be used to evolve Magmar into Magmortar.
- Trade Magmar: Trading is the only way to evolve Magmar into Magmortar. You need to trade Magmar with another player while it is holding the Magmarizer.
